Why do people switch insurance carriers?

When the costs of the insurance outweigh the benefits of staying with a particular company, policyholders tend to switch to an insurer that can give them more for their money. So check every six to 12 months with your insurer and others to make sure you’re getting the best deal. Feb 22, 2022

How often do people switch insurance companies?

After all good customer service, loyalty and bundling rewards, and an established record of no recent claims is a big incentive to stay put. At the same time, there are certainly a lot of reasons why customers switch companies every five years or so. You should never assume you have the best coverage year to year.

How often do people change their insurance?

About half of respondents in a new survey said they changed their health plan in the past three years, according to the independent public relations firm Finn Partners.
